This website called Objective Lists has a Country Similarity Index that measures how similar or dissimilar one country is from another, and one of the main categories is demographics, which is given a score out of 20 for each country based on the rubric listed above.
**The 10 Most Demographically Similar Countries to Canada are:**
1. Australia (18/20)
2. United Kingdom (17.3/20)
3. United States (17.2/20)
4. New Zealand (17.1/20)
5. Switzerland (17/20)
6. Belgium (16.8/20)
7. Ireland (16.7/20)
8. Sweden (16.4/20)
9. Norway (16.3/20)
10. France (16.1/20)
**The 10 Least Demographically Similar Countries to Canada are:**
1. Niger (4.1/20)
2. Mali (4.4/20)
3. Senegal (4.5/20)
4. Guinea (4.81/20)
5. Burkina Faso (5/20)
6. Somalia (5.1/20)
7. Laos (5.2/20)
8. Yemen (5.4/20)
9. Sierra Leone (5.5/20)
10. Guinea Bissau (5.6/20)
